⊕ 04 — Treatment protocol

The Dundee protocol.

For Dundee jobs, a typical wasps treatment is single same-day insecticidal-dust treatment to the access point, with a 24-hour quiet period before the nest is safe to remove. Operators on our Scotland network carry the relevant CRRU / RSPH certifications and provide a written report you can share with a Dundee landlord, letting agent or the local environmental health team.

◉ 05 — Early signs

What wasps look like in a Dundee home.

  • 01steady traffic to a single entry point
  • 02papery nest visible in the loft
  • 03buzzing inside ceilings on warm afternoons

Q · 05
Should I report a wasps problem to Dundee environmental health?
For domestic jobs, no — a private treatment is faster. Report to Dundee environmental health if the issue originates next door, in a shared block, or from a commercial premises. Operators issue paperwork in the format EHOs accept.
Q · 06
Is treatment safe around children and pets?
Yes. Operators use products approved for domestic use and will brief you on any short re-entry windows. For wasps, the protocol is single same-day insecticidal-dust treatment to the access point.
